SEAN COYLEArtistic and Executive Director
Sean Coyle has been a frequent collaborator with Relative Theatrics since 2014. He has worked as a lighting designer, actor, director and as a teaching artist for Play/Write. He holds a B.A. in Theatrical Performance from the University of Wyoming and a Master's of Library Science and Information from the University of Central Missouri. He has always had a passion for the performing arts and how the in person experience of art can create deeper connections for individuals and their communities. He hopes to continue and expand the mission of Relative Theatrics to bring high quality theatre to the Southeast Wyoming community.

KIM LOCKHARTProduction Manager
Kim holds a BFA in Theatre Playwriting and Directing from the University of Wyoming. She took over the position of Production Manager the summer of 2021, for Season 9. Since joining the Relative Theatrics family, Kim has also had the opportunity to act in RIDING BICYCLES IN THE RAIN and ROZ RAY. She has designed props for several shows, stage manage, and was the director for BRILLIANT TRACES, BURST and most recently WITCH. Along with all this Kim is one of the teaching artists for the Play/Write education program Relative Theatrics started in 2022. Kim loves that she has the opportunity to be a part of bringing these thought provoking stories to the stage as well as meeting and working with the many talented artists in the Laramie/Wyoming community.

BEN BOYD
Technical Director
Ben is a Digital Media and Lighting Designer, having had designs showcased at Theatre Silco in Silverthorne, CO, Grandstreet Theatre in Helena, MT, and Relative Theatrics and the University of Wyoming in Laramie, WY. Recent design credits include Projection Design for THE HALF LIFE OF MARIE CURIE, Lighting Design for THE MOUSETRAP, Lighting and Projection Design for THE SPONGEBOB MUSICAL. With Relative Theatrics he has done Lighting Design for HEROES OF THE FOURTH TURNING, WITCH and ROZ AND RAY. Ben joined as Technical Director in February of 2025.

WILLIAM BOWLINGEducation Director
Will is a writer, performer and musician recently transplanted in Laramie. He is the Founding Artistic Director of the New Orleans based company, Goat In The Road, and has spent the last 13 years in the Crescent City making original, ensemble devised performance works with a company of friends and artists. Additionally, he works extensively with New Orleans ensembles Mondo Bizarro and Artspot Productions, and is in the current national touring ensemble of Cry You One. Will is thrilled to be here in Laramie working with Relative and a wonderful ensemble of Wyoming based artists.
